Genre: Coming-of-age, Romance
Synopsis: Twin sisters navigate life anew and discover true love after swapping their identities through a web of lies.
No. of episodes: 12
Cast: Park Bo-young, Park Jin-young, Ryu Kyung-soo
Screenwriter: Lee Kang
Director: Park Shin-woo
Network: tvN
Streaming platform: Netflix
Date: May 24, 2025

Netflix English subtitle translation:

Jane Jung, Soya Back
